2001 Rewind: Donnie Darko
It's hard to believe, but 2001 was 25 years ago. Over the next few weeks I'm going to be looking at some stand out films from 2001 that are turning 25 in 2026. Today, it's a unique independent drama.
Donnie: I hope that when the world comes to an end, I can breathe a sigh of relief, because there will be so much to look forward to.
Donnie Darko
Starring: Jake Gyllenhaal, Jena Malone, Holmes Osborne, Mary Malone, and Maggie Gyllenhaal
Director: Richard Kelly
About: This is a strange and unique cinematic journey. Gyllenhaal--both of them--is great here. I enjoy this wild and creatively dark science fiction tale from Kelly. I remember seeing this during my time in college and being taken with the use of music and the storytelling. Now 25 years later, that's still the case. This is an off-beat choice that isn't the most popular film on the list, but it's one of the most memorable from that year to me. If you like strange tales and haven't seen it, this is worth seeking out.
